We have a training database that we're going to setup as a flashbackable database (is that a word?). The requirement is to take the restore point on Monday, do the training and then flashback to the Monday restore point on Friday evening/Saturday morning.

This training database currently is not flashback enabled and generates regular amounts of redo etc.

Here's my first question: Can I look at the existing training database and query the amount of redo activity generated to calculate the flashback area size that I need to setup? I'll want to be able to flashback to any point during the week on the off chance they really fubar something and need to go back a day.

If this is true, what view(s) do I need to look at to drive my calculations?

Second question: In the event I need to do a flashback to a the day before (say Thursday back to Wednesday) will I still be able to flashback to Monday once I get to Friday night? I assume the answer to this is yes as long as the Monday flashback is a guaranteed flashback recovery point. Please correct me if I'm wrong on that or need additional guidance.
